The Philippine House Committee on Health, or House Health Committee is a standing committee of the Philippine House of Representatives.
Jurisdiction
As prescribed by House Rules, the committee's jurisdiction includes the following:[1]
- Public health and hygiene
- Quarantine, medical, hospital and other health facilities and services
